Sweden’s Amelie Aldner embraces soulful brilliance in ‘Touch Me’

Effortlessly blending heartfelt lyricism with gospel-infused undercurrents, Amelie Aldner delivers a track that feels as intimate as a whispered confession yet powerful enough to echo in the grand halls of pop greatness. ‘Touch Me’ is tender, warm, and shimmering with the golden glow of Scandinavian pop brilliance. Amelie’s ability to channel personal emotion into universal resonance shines here. Her voice—a dynamic instrument reminiscent of Whitney Houston’s warmth and Alicia Keys’ sincerity – soars and softens in all the right places. Each note feels purposeful, like a bridge connecting her story to ours.

With its lush production and Amelie’s velvety vocals at the forefront, ‘Touch Me’ recalls the soulful vulnerability of Adele and the expansive emotional landscapes crafted by Lady Gaga. The song’s sweeping chorus carries an almost celestial quality, as if it were plucked from the stars and set to melody. Beneath the track’s smooth surface, subtle gospel harmonies ripple like sunlight on water, grounding its ethereal tone with a soulful depth.

“I wanted to reach that deepest part of myself, a love that resonates with people, and connect with them, give them my love. Each track is a piece of me and tells a story that I’ve lived and that I know many others have to.”
